Experiencing Fluctuations in Temperature Level


Your hot water heater has a thermostat, and the water created should remain around that exact same temperature you establish for the system. However, if your water comes to be also chilly or also hot suddenly, it could imply that your water heater thermostat is no more doing its job. Initially, examination points out by utilizing a pen as well as tape. Then check to see later if the noting go on its very own. It means your heating system is unpredictable if it does.

Making Insufficient Hot Water


If there is inadequate warm water for you and also your family, yet you have not altered your intake behaviors, then that's the indication that your water heater is falling short. Typically, expanding households as well as an additional washroom suggest that you need to scale up to a larger device to fulfill your demands.
Nonetheless, when everything is the same, but your water heater suddenly doesn't meet your hot water requirements, take into consideration a professional inspection because your machine is not performing to requirement.

Seeing Leaks and also Pools


Check to connectors, screws, as well as pipes when you see a water leak. You might simply require to tighten several of them. If you see puddles gathered at the base of the home heating device, you need to call for an immediate inspection due to the fact that it shows you've obtained an active leakage that might be a problem with your tank itself or the pipelines.

Hearing Unusual Sounds


When unusual sounds like touching and also knocking on your device, this shows sediment build-up. It is akin to stratified rocks, which are hard as well as make a great deal of sound when banging against steel. If left neglected, these items can produce tears on the steel, causing leakages.
You can still save your water heater by draining it and cleaning it. Simply be careful since dealing with this is harmful, whether it is a gas or electrical unit.

Discovering Stinky or over Cast Water


Does your water unexpectedly have an odor like rotten eggs as well as look unclean? Your water heating unit might be acting up if you smell something weird. Your water needs to be clean as well as fresh smelling as previously. If not, you can have rust accumulation and also bacteria contamination. It suggests the integrated anode rod in your device is no more doing its work, so you need it replaced stat.

Aging Beyond Criterion Life-span


If your water heater is even more than ten years old, you have to take into consideration replacing it. You might consider water heating unit substitute if you understand your water heating unit is old, paired with the various other problems pointed out over.

Recognizing the Signs of a Damaged Water Heater


Winter may be mostly behind us but having hot water in our homes is a necessity year-round. A broken water heater can be a time-consuming and costly problem.



Recognizing the signs of a water heater in distress, and knowing what to do about it, is the best way to avoid a full-blown water heater "meltdown."



Sediment buildup, rust, and high water pressure are some of the most common causes of water heater failure. Improper installation or equipment sizing are other commonly found issues. A leak can occur near the supply line which can cause damage to dry wall or flooring.



Like any appliance, frequent checks can prevent your water heater from becoming a big problem. Try to set an annual reminder to check for water pooling around your water heater and to tighten any loose fittings you might find. The quicker the issue is resolved, the less damage it will cause in the end.



If you do find signs that your water heater is broken or about to burst, the first thing to do is to shut it off. For gas water heaters, twist the dial at the top of the thermostat from ON to OFF. If it’s an electric heater, switch the circuit breaker to OFF.


Once the water heater is turned off follow these steps:


  • Turn off the water supply.


  • Completely drain the water heater.


  • Open the pressure relief valve.


  • Rinse the water heater with cold water when the unit has finished draining.
